Abstract
Optimum conditions are described for the HPLC determination of submicromolar and nanomolar concentrations of 2-, 3-, and 4-aminobiphenyls in deionized water, drinking water and river water. The limits of the detection with a boron-doped diamond film electrode are ca. 10-7 mol l-1. Using solid phase extraction with diethyl ether as eluent, the limits decrease to 10-8 - 10-9 mol l-1.
